i have a 24ft flat bed beaver tail trailer that i pull with my dually. the hook up is with the ball in the bed of my truck, not a 5th wheel. i just purchased a 30 some odd ft goose neck travel trailer, prowler, which requires a 5th wheel hook up. my question is, can i convert from needing the 5th wheel hook up to the ball hook up by altering the trailer? is it legal, is costly, is it do-able and how? i really don't want to have the 2 hook ups and i will be using the flat bed regularly and the travel trailer twice a year for sure.

any help appreciated or where to look for info. rick
